All About Me (2018): A Heartfelt Comedy Drama — Full Movie Info
Caroline Link's *All About Me (2018)* dives into the early life of Hape Kerkeling, one of Germany's most cherished comedians, blending drama and comedy into a heartfelt portrait of ambition, identity, and resilience. The film captures Kerkeling's journey from a small-town boy to a rising star, filled with humor and emotional depth that reflect his real-life experiences. With a backdrop of 1970s West Germany, the story explores themes of self-discovery, family dynamics, and the pressures of showbiz, all wrapped in a tone that's both uplifting and poignant.
The cast shines, with Julius Weckauf delivering a standout performance as the young Kerkeling, while Luise Heyer and Sönke Möhring add layers of authenticity to the supporting roles. Link's direction balances wit and warmth, making *All About Me (2018)* more than just a biopic—it's a celebration of perseverance and the power of laughter to heal and inspire.
